On-Site Consultation Program
Free Consulting Service for all Workplace Safety Needs
Under a grant from OSHA the Safety Bureau will provide, at an employer's request, a confidential comprehensive safety and health consultation at no cost. Consultations are limited to employers with less than 250 employees. Employers in high hazard industries are given priority. Phone: (406) 444-6418.
WHAT WE CAN DO FOR YOU
Our consultation services are confidential, conducted at no charge, and may include:
- Assistance in the identification and control of safety and health hazards in your workplace
- Explanation of federal workplace safety and health standard requirements and how they apply to your business
- Training for your employees in safe working practices
- Training for your employees in the use of personal protective equipment
- Explanation of the requirements of the Montana Safety Culture Act
With your cooperation and commitment an effective consultation will reduce workplace injuries and illnesses.
WHO CAN REQUEST A CONSULTATION
Private employers may request this service by contacting the Department of Labor and Industry. Consultations will be scheduled on a first-come, first-serve basis, with priority granted to small business employers in high hazard industries.
PROCEDURE
The consultation is conducted in three phases:
PHASE 1: THE OPENING CONFERENCE
You will be provided with a detailed explanation of the program, your safety and health programs will be reviewed, and pertinent accident and injury records will be examined.
PHASE 2: THE WALK THROUGH
A workplace survey will be conducted with you or a designee.
PHASE 3: THE CLOSING CONFERENCE
You will discuss with the consultant the existing or potential hazards identified, and the recommendations on how to control or eliminate the identified hazards.
A complete confidential written report that summarizes the findings and suggests remedial measures for identified hazards will be provided at a later date.
EMPLOYERS OBLIGATION
You are required to immediately eliminate any imminent danger and correct any serious safety or health condition within a specified time period.
**There are no fees charged for the consultation nor are fines or penalties levied for any safety or health hazards identified during the consultation.**
